Tempest Technology Corporation: Company Profile
Background
Overview
Tempest Technology Corporation is a leading manufacturer of fire and rescue equipment in the United States, specializing in the design and production of lifesaving tools such as seismic sensors, search cameras, stability controllers, lifesaving struts, and electrical current detectors. The company also offers specialized blowers and fans utilized across various industries, including oil and gas, railroads, construction, confined space applications, and hot air ballooning.

Industry Significance
Established in 1987, Tempest has become a prominent player in the fire equipment manufacturing industry, recognized for its commitment to quality and innovation. The company's products are integral to the operations of fire departments, search and rescue teams, and various industrial sectors, contributing significantly to safety and operational efficiency.

Areas of Specialization
Tempest specializes in the development of advanced fire and rescue equipment, including:
- Seismic Sensors: Devices designed to detect and measure seismic activity, crucial for structural assessments during emergencies.
- Search Cameras: High-resolution imaging tools used in search and rescue operations to locate victims in challenging environments.
- Stability Controllers: Equipment that ensures the structural integrity of buildings and other structures during rescue operations.
- Lifesaving Struts: Support devices that provide temporary stabilization to structures, allowing safe access for rescue teams.
- Electrical Current Detectors: Tools that identify live electrical hazards, enhancing safety during rescue missions.
